A variation of the LI/LITVA legend
Obverse: in the cord rim, a narrow-bodied eagle with its head heraldically to the right, with a spread tail, with four-pronged paws; in the outer rim, a legend punctuated by three leaves: SIGIS AVG REX PO MAG DVX LI;
Reverse: in the corded rim, the Pogon to the left, below it the date 1547, in the outer rim the legend divided by three leaves:
COIN MAGNI DVCAT9 LITVA;
